MONTGOMERY: PSE&G sets electrical upgrade

   MONTGOMERY — PSE&G is planning to improve the electrical infrastructure in the Montgomery Township area.
   The initial phase included new supply circuits into the area that was completed in November 2010.
   The next phase of the project is to convert two customer-owned substations in the area of the new supply lines by the end of 2011.
   The third phase of the project is scheduled to be completed by summer 2013, and will include the construction of a new substation, which will replace the existing old Rocky Hill station in Montgomery Township.
   The work will take place in the following areas from September 2011 through June 2013: Route 601 and Route 518 traveling east to Route 206; Route 518 and Route 601 traveling north; Route 206 in the area of Princeton Airport; and Route 518 and Route 206 traveling north.
